What is the hourly salary range of Electrical Software Engineer?

As of January 01, 2026, the average hourly pay of Electrical Software Engineer in the United States is $58. While Salary.com is seeing that Electrical Software Engineer salary in the US can go up to $68 or down to $49, but most earn between $54 and $63. What is An Electrical Software Engineer ?

The salary for an Electrical Software Engineer varies based on factors such as experience, education, location, and the specific industry. Typically, entry-level positions may start around $70,000 annually, while mid-level engineers can earn between $90,000 and $120,000. Senior engineers or those in specialized roles may command salaries exceeding $130,000. Additional benefits, such as bonuses, stock options, and health insurance, can further enhance overall compensation. Geographic location plays a significant role, with urban areas and tech hubs often offering higher salaries to attract top ...

These charts show the average hourly wage (core compensation), as well as the average total hourly cash compensation for the job of Electrical Software Engineer in the United States. The average hourly rate for Electrical Software Engineer ranges from $54 to $63 with the average hourly pay of $58. The total hourly cash compensation, which includes base and short-term incentives, can vary anywhere from $58 to $71 with the average total hourly cash compensation of $64.
